Common Bathroom Sink Plumbing Jobs
Drain repairs - fixing clogs and leaks in bathroom sink drains to prevent water damage.
Faucet replacement - upgrading or replacing outdated or faulty bathroom sink faucets.
Leak detection - identifying hidden leaks to avoid water waste and property damage.
Pipe repairs - restoring damaged or corroded supply lines and drain pipes under the sink.
Installation services - installing new bathroom sinks and related plumbing fixtures.
Maintenance checks - inspecting plumbing components to ensure proper function and prevent issues.
Bathroom Sink Plumbing Questions
What are common bathroom sink plumbing issues? Common problems include leaks, clogs, low water pressure, and dripping faucets that may require repairs or replacements.
When should a bathroom sink drain be cleaned? Drains should be cleaned when slow drainage or frequent clogs occur to prevent backups and maintain proper flow.
What types of fixtures can be installed or replaced? Fixtures such as faucets, aerators, and drain assemblies can be installed or replaced to improve function and appearance.
How can I prevent bathroom sink leaks? Regularly checking for loose fittings and replacing worn-out washers or seals can help prevent leaks and water damage.
